Array of fibonacci numbers

Assignment Help Basic Computer Science
Reference no: EM131268797

Write a Java program that generates an array of Fibonacci numbers. Add comments to the program.

Specifications:

1. Fills a one-dimensional array with the first 30 Fibonacci numbers using a calculation to generate the numbers. Note: it is not permissible to initialize the array explicitly with the Fibonacci series' first 30 numbers!

2. Prints the Fibonacci numbers in the array

3. Prompts the user to input an (integer) number between 1 and 30 (inclusive) and prints in response to the user entry: The nth Fibonacci number is X, where n is the number input by the user and X is the Fibonacci number in the nth position. (Remember that array indexes for the elements of the array start at 0)

4. Checks that the user has not input a number lower than 1 or higher than 30

You can check if you have the right numbers here:

Reference no: EM131268797

Questions Cloud

Draw a copy of the given in risa two-d and solve the mistake : Draw a copy of the attachement in RISA 2D and solve the mistake and the mistake. There is a typographic error on the frame diagram, in the first bay the upper dimension for the span and the load should be 12' instead of 8'.
Health data breach response plan : As the Chief Privacy Officer (CPO) of a competitive managed care organization, you have been advised of a breach in the privacy, security and confidentiality of sensitive patient data that occurred at the hands of an employee who was a willing partic..
Taxonomy of multiple-access protocols : Q1. Draw the taxonomy of Multiple-access Protocols. Q2. What is the advantage of token passing protocol over CSMA/CD protocol?
What does say about the shape of the graph of the ppi : A government report states that the rate of change of inflation for producer prices is decreasing. What does this say about the shape of the graph of the PPI?
Array of fibonacci numbers : Write a Java program that generates an array of Fibonacci numbers. Add comments to the program.
Behavior is a function of its consequences : The best motivator in the workplace is usually money versus The best motivator in the workplace is usually not money. What do you think determines how a company decides to structure itself? What is the difference between diversity and affirmative act..
Draw the constraint graph : CS 3346a - CS 3121a Assignment. Draw the constraint graph (HINT: all of the constraints are binary and bidirectional); show an initial queue with the constraints in the order given above (the A-D constraint at the front of the queue) and then show h..
Write a paper describing its security features : Select a NOSQL database (MongoDB, Cassandra, DynamoDB, BigTable, etc...) and write a paper describing its security features - which model is implemented, granularity of the access control
Quantification of decision rules in healthcare environment : The NHS QOF effort is obviously full of very specific point systems for evaluation. What are the strengths and weaknesses of such quantification of decision rules in a healthcare environment?

Reviews

Write a Review

Basic Computer Science Questions & Answers

  Web page increases the communication channels

Selecting font type, style, color, and size are essential in designing a Web site. Even when a Web designer presents valuable information, meaningful multimedia or engaging interaction, if audiences have a difficult time reading it, the Web site w..

  Objectives of brainstorming meeting

What are the objectives of brainstorming meeting that is held among the engagement team members?

  How to make the mail secure

How to make the mail secure As introduced in the proposal instruction, a proposal should include the following parts (more details see: https://people.ok.ubc.ca/rlawrenc/teaching/writingProposal.html):

  Formulate the tautology underlying the rule

For each of the arguments below, formalize them in propositional logic. If the argument is valid identify which inference rule was used, and formulate the tautology underlying the rule. If the argument is invalid, state whether the inverse or conve..

  What is the gulf of execution

1. How does Norman define "execution" and "evaluation"? 2. What is the Gulf of Execution? Give an example. 3. What is the Gulf of Evaluation? Give an example?

  Business process engineering

Does LEAN practice concepts align closely with Business Process Engineering?

  Name of the processor-manufacturer-model

Review three processors of your choice. Please answer the following questions In the order listed. a. Name of the processor, manufacturer, model/series number and related.

  Definition of organizational learning

Please provide a definition of organizational learning (OL). Is there a difference between the notion of "Organizational Learning" (OL) and that of the "Learning Organization" (LO)? Are we humanizing organizations when we say that they "learn"? (1..

  Support a risk mitigation plan

Senior management at Health Network allocated funds to support a risk mitigation plan, and have requested that the risk manager and team create a plan in response to the deliverables produced within the earlier phases of the project.

  Specific ways that shape competition

Identify and briefly describe five specific areas where IT represents a risk to a company's competitive advantage.

  What is the current state of solid-state drives

What is the current state of solid-state drives vs. hard disks? Do original research online where you can compare price on solid-state drives and hard disks. Be sure you note the differences in price, capacity, and speed.

  Main conclusion of the argument

Since safe driving should be incentivized by the law, the state's no-fault insurance statute should be dropped. In a state with no-fault insurance the insurer of an injured driver pays for damages even if the driver is not at fault.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d